Transaction 149533e7aec80a2afea53d25a9f7f343b8a3da842ab19f4fa3b00e86f4ed6896

1 Input
2 Outputs
  • 149533e7aec80a2afea53d25a9f7f343b8a3da842ab19f4fa3b00e86f4ed6896:0
  • value  1714135
    address  1EP6KEwDDedCjFQhBhdDLZNvMMMcAmCrbb
  • 149533e7aec80a2afea53d25a9f7f343b8a3da842ab19f4fa3b00e86f4ed6896:1
  • value  36079844
    address  3KEoETrXBPkLyiW6mAWJmpqiEPiVg9veEt